Quote: Originally Posted By andru2797 on 3/19/2010
Well, I'm not really sure about this deal. I really like Kesler and he plays a fantastic two way game, but when did 20 goals and 60 points for 5 million a season become a great deal? I think Alex Burrows is the same calibre of player Kesler is and he got a 4 year deal worth 2 million per. Something doesn't add up there.

To be clear, I'm not necessarily saying Kesler didn't deserve this kind of deal if you look at solely him, but this deal throws the salary structure of this team completely out of whack in my opinion because it's too close to what the Sedins make and too far from what Burrows makes, all of which are fairly recent deals.
You answered your own questions? 66 points in 71 games worth 5 mill? Maybe not. Selke finalist worth 5 mill? Maybe not. Put them together and you got yourself a wonderful deal. Burrows was signed to a bargain deal and is underpaid. Also, you can't build a line around Burrows like Kesler. Burrows is a complimentary scorer and and a defensive specialist.

If you spent that 5 mill on another player as a free agent next season. Believe me, you would not like the trade off.
